Transaction 21a08ae789faf54ca90e334832f22df831ce0da7c16feb230f7841893c99b5df

1 Input
2 Outputs
  • 21a08ae789faf54ca90e334832f22df831ce0da7c16feb230f7841893c99b5df:0
  • value  4240558
    address  3QR5r6C6eKLxHYUksGLbDy89AUicMjZ2TD
  • 21a08ae789faf54ca90e334832f22df831ce0da7c16feb230f7841893c99b5df:1
  • value  6933375
    address  1PDgaZfrTspSAd4nuyg3gvmCYeTbNjaJWG